About Me
Hello! I’m Ashaduzzaman, a dedicated and technically adept professional with a deep passion for Artificial Intelligence, Data Science, and Machine Learning. My expertise spans Large Language Models (LLMs), Generative AI, Natural Language Processing (NLP), Computer Vision, and Multimodal Vision-Language Models. I aim to apply my skills to create innovative and impactful solutions in AI/ML research and real-world applications.
Experience
Research Assistant
BRAC University
- Conducted research on Bangladesh’s RMG industry, focusing on supply chain visibility, ESG indices, sustainability practices, and renewable energy adoption.
Key projects include:
- Mapping export-oriented factories in Bangladesh (MiB) – Link Map
- Exploring Adoption of Renewable Energy Technology (RET) among Apparel Exporters – Link
- Addressing Climate Change and Plastic Waste in Bangladesh’s Garment Industry – Link
Research Interest
Large Language Models (LLMs), Natural Language Processing (NLP), Generative AI, Computer Vision, Vision Language Models (VLMs)
Academic Background
Bachelor of Science (BSc) in Electrical and Electronic Engineering
BRAC University, Dhaka, Bangladesh | Year: 2021
Higher Secondary Certificate (HSC)
Cantonment Public School and College, Rangpur, Bangladesh | Year: 2014
Certifications
IBM AI Engineering Specialization
- Mastered machine learning, deep learning, neural networks, and key ML algorithms including classification, regression, clustering, and dimensional reduction.
- Implemented supervised and unsupervised models using SciPy and Scikit-Learn.
- Deployed machine learning algorithms and pipelines on Apache Spark.
Built deep learning models with Keras, PyTorch, and TensorFlow for various applications.
- Skills Gained: Machine Learning, Deep Learning, Neural Networks, Python Programming, Computer Vision, Applied ML, ML Algorithms, Regression, Mathematical Analysis.
Building LLM-Powered Applications
Build LLM-powered applications with entire process of designing, experimenting, evaluating and deploying LLM-based apps using LLM APIs, LangChain and W&B Prompts.
Skills Gained: MLOps, Weights & Biases, Large Language Models, LangChain, Prompt Engineering
Training and Fine-tuning Large Language Models (LLMs)
Gained hands-on experience in building, training and fine-tuning Large Language Models (LLMs) from scratch to enhancing their performance.
Skills Gained: MLOps, Weights & Biases, Large Language Models (LLMs), LLM Training, Fine-tuning LLMs, LoRA (Low-Rank Adaptation)
Deep Learning Specialization
Certified by DeepLearning.AI & Coursera
- Built and trained deep neural networks, implementing vectorized architectures for real-world applications.
- Developed CNNs for detection and recognition tasks, utilizing neural style transfer for creative image generation.
Constructed RNNs and applied NLP techniques using Hugging Face transformers for Named Entity Recognition and Question Answering.
- Skills Gained: Machine Learning, Deep Learning, Artificial Neural Networks, Machine Learning Algorithms, Applied ML, Python Programming, Network Modeling, Computer Vision, Network Architecture, and Human Learning.
Machine Learning Specialization
Certified by Stanford Online & DeepLearning.AI
- Designed and trained machine learning models with NumPy and scikit-learn, mastering supervised learning for prediction and binary classification.
- Developed decision trees and ensemble methods, employing best practices for model development.
Built recommender systems using collaborative filtering and deep reinforcement learning techniques.
- Skills Gained: Machine Learning, Machine Learning Algorithms, Applied Machine Learning, Deep Learning, Artificial Neural Networks, Human Learning, Python Programming, Regression, Mathematics, Critical Thinking, and Network Modeling.
IBM Data Science Specialization
- Acquired practical skills and knowledge essential for data scientists, including Python and SQL.
- Executed data importing, cleaning, analysis, and visualization, creating machine learning models and pipelines.
Completed real-world projects, building a portfolio to demonstrate proficiency to potential employers.
- Skills Gained: Data Mining, Deep Learning, Machine Learning, SQL Database Administration, Python Programming, Statistical Modeling, Data Quality, Big Data, Web Applications, RStudio, Jupyter Notebooks, GitHub, Analytical Skills, Problem Solving, Communication, Solution-oriented approach, Datasets, Methodology, Scripting, Generative AI, Data Science
TensorFlow Developer Specialization
Certified by DeepLearning.AI & Coursera
- Mastered TensorFlow to train neural networks for computer vision applications, implementing strategies to prevent overfitting.
Developed natural language processing systems and trained RNNs, GRUs, and LSTMs using text data.
- Skills Gained: Machine Learning, Deep Learning, Machine Learning Algorithms, Artificial Neural Networks, Applied Machine Learning, Human Learning, Computer Programming, Python Programming, Computer Vision, Network Models, Data Visualization.